R&B singer Mario is currently mourning the loss of his mother, Shawntia Hardaway. The 31-year-old artist shared the sad news on his Instagram page.

Mario shared a photo of his mother as a young child next to a photo himself as a youngster. In the caption, he wrote, “Your soul lives forever beside me. We love you Shawntia Hardaway. I love you eternally.”

There’s no word on cause of death, but Mario has been very candid about his mother’s addiction to heroin. The “Let Me Love You” singer has worked tirelessly to get her clean, even supported her through her drug rehab stint.

However, in 2010, Mario was arrested for fighting with his mother at her Baltimore home. The singer was charged with second-degree assault, which was later dropped. At the time, the singer's lawyer called the incident "unfortunate" but maintains that Mario was trying to help his mother who was "struggling with a devastating addiction."

After the incident, Mario and his mother separated, which helped their relationship. “There are so many different variables but we’re good. We have better communication, better respect and understanding," Mario told Madame Noire in 2013. "That space allowed her to be a woman instead of me being the guardian over her telling her what to do. It allowed me to grow as a man, and it allowed her to decide where she wanted her life to go."
